Communities in Schools for Forsyth County 
Forsyth County
500 West Fourth St. Suite 102 Winston Salem NC 27101 336-750-3488 sroglesby_cisws@yahoo.com Exec. Director, Renee Oglesby; Site Manager, Terry Andrews

Type of organization: Independent Non-profit
What organization does: CIS offers tutoring assistance in schools and at various other sites. Pre-K literacy groups and after-school tutoring are available as well as graduation coaches for students needing extra help in order to graduate on time.

Shepherd's Center of Greater Winston-Salem - Intergenerational Reading Program 
Forsyth County
1700 Ebert Street Winston Salem, NC 27103 336-748 - 0217

Type of organization: Faith Based Organization
What organization does: Volunteers go twice monthly to various pre-school centers around Forsyth County to provide intergenerational enrichment experiences. During their visits, they may offer: reading and storytelling, creative arts, music, rhythm and movement, and games.
